PENGARUH PEMAKAIAN ALAT PENGHEMAT BAHAN BAKAR POWER X TERHADAP PERFORMANCE MOTOR DIESEL -, Sudarsono
JURNAL TEKNOLOGI TECHNOSCIENTIA Academia Ista Vol 9 Edisi Khusus Oktober 2004
Publisher : Lembaga Penelitian & Pengabdian Kepada Masyarakat (LPPM), IST AKPRIND Yogyakarta

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(450.566 KB) | DOI: 10.34151/technoscientia.v0i0.1897

Abstract

The performance of combustion engine of torak can be seen from torque, break power, , the break mean effective pressure, fuel consumption, specific fuel consumption, AFR and efficiency produced. The research discusses the effect of fuel saving consumption “Power X” to the performance of diesel motor. The research used speed average such as 1600, 1950, 2300, 2650, 3000 Rpm. The result showed that the use of Power X caused torque increased 3,160782 Nm or 2,72%, power increased 0,7613 kW or 2,74%, effective pressure increased 18,3622 kPa or 2.73%. Fuel consumption decreased 0,3572 gr/second or 14,34 %, specific fuel consumption decreased 0,01516 mg/joule or 16,83%. Ratio between air and fuel increased 1,8476 or 14,67%. Thermal efficiency increased 0,05102 or 20,19 %.

PENGARUH SUHU DAN KONSENTRASI ZAT PENGAKTIF NaCl TERHADAP KUALITAS RENDEMEN DAN DAYA SERAP ARANG AKTIF Andaka, Ganjar; Astuti, Tri
JURNAL TEKNOLOGI TECHNOSCIENTIA Academia Ista Vol 10 Edisi Khusus September 2005
Publisher : Lembaga Penelitian & Pengabdian Kepada Masyarakat (LPPM), IST AKPRIND Yogyakarta

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(193.648 KB) | DOI: 10.34151/technoscientia.v0i0.1899

Abstract

Coffee shell contains a lot of cellulose which can be used as a raw material to produces activated carbon. The demand of activated carbon tends to increase because it is used for a great variety of purposes, including the decolorizing of solutions of sugar, industrial chemicals, drugs, and dry-cleaning liquids, water purification, refining of vegetable and animal oils, and in recovery of gold and silver from cyanide ore-leach solutions. This investigation studied effect of tempeture and concentration of sodium chloride (as activator) on yield (rendement) and adsorption potential of activated carbon. In this investigation, coffee shell was dipped into the solution of sodium chloride with certain concentration and then it was carbonized into the muffle furnace. The carbon coke formed was then washed by using hot water and dried into the oven. The dried carbon coke was weighed and then tested the adsorption potential. The results of this investigation show that the yield (rendement) and adsorption potential of activated carbon increase with increasing the concentration of sodium chloride, but above the sodium chloride concentration of 20% the yield and adsorption potential of activated carbon tend to decrase. While the adsorption potential of activated carbon increases with temperature of carbonization, the yield of activated carbon decreases with temperature of carbonization, but above the carbonization tempeature of 600oC the adsorption potential of activated carbon tends to decreases.
